The charming SORAT Hotel just off Marienplatz in the town centre opened its hand-carved doors in 1993 in a delightfully restored Jugendstil merchant's house. After much collaboration with the local authorities on how best to preserve this listed building the imposing Jungendstil facade was restored complete with its oriel tower and the ornamental plasterwork in the rooms was carefully restored and painted in original tones as was the highly ornate reception area. Our 46 rooms are highly individual and come in a wide range of styles and sizes from period oriel rooms or rooms with balconies to romantic garrets. Furnishings are kept in a predominantly Jugendstil style in order to suit the character of the building. Meanwhile the rooms also come with all modern comforts such as shower and bath with WC direct-dial telephone fax connection minibar and cable TV. All parts of the hotel have disabled access and we have three separate rooms for disabled guests. One of the oriel rooms is also a conference room for up to 20 people featuring plenty of natural daylight and its own charming atmosphere under the stucco.
